Brought some home this morning to fillet and put in the freezer for a few meals. Fished from 7:00 to 10:30. Was using a 1/32 oz jig and worms. caught fish from water surface to about three feet.

I've thought about doing that Techno2000, but haven't tried it. Was thinking it might not be easy to cast a fly without throwing the worm off the hook. Mostly, however, I just like a UL spinning rod when fishing with worms from my float tube. Easy to cast and easy to lay the short rod in my lap while removing the jig or hook from the fish's mouth and putting it on the stringer, etc. I enjoy the fly rod at times, but I've never preferred it to the exclusion of spinning gear.
